FIA signs MoU with Aspire Group to offer fee concessions for employees’ children

ISLAMABAD, Feb 01 (APP):The Federal Investigation Agency (FIA) has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Aspire Group of Colleges to provide special educational fee concessions for the children of FIA employees across the country.
Under the agreement, 100 percent fee concession will be granted to the children of martyr and deceased FIA employees, while 50 percent concession will be offered to the children of serving FIA personnel and 25 percent concession to the children of retired FIA employees.
A senior FIA official told APP on Sunday that the MoU aims to facilitate access to quality education for the families of FIA personnel and reflects the organization’s continued commitment to the welfare of its employees and their dependents.
He said that the initiative is part of broader welfare measures being undertaken by FIA to support its workforce, particularly the families of those who have rendered valuable services to the country.
According to the agreement, children of eligible FIA employees will be able to avail the fee concessions at Aspire Group institutions across Pakistan, enabling them to pursue education in a supportive and affordable environment.
The official added that FIA believes investment in education is essential for building a stronger future, and such partnerships with reputable educational institutions help ensure better learning opportunities for the children of law enforcement personnel.
The MoU signing ceremony was attended by senior representatives of FIA and Aspire Group, who expressed hope that the initiative would significantly benefit FIA families and strengthen cooperation between the two institutions.
